The Blue Tarp, a radio program and podcast, covers the stories of the people and places of Alaska’s Northern Susitna Valley. We strive to share the stories of this area with the many voices who lived them.  History is being made every day so the stories might be decades old or more current.  With this show, we hope to cover many facets of the Susitna Valley story. Seasons 1-4 are available on-demand. Season 5 started March 16, 2024.

Liquid Assets, a radio program and podcast, started airing on KTNA in early 2023. Host Jenny Willoughby dives deep into all things water-related. Covering topics from the elementary water cycle and weird weather to diseases and pests, it’s a little bit of science packed into a few minutes and will make you say H2Ohhhh. Six Minute Science, produced and hosted by KTNA’s Jenny Willoughby, promises to be a weekly cram session of everything weird and wonderful about science. We’ll learn about fire, mushrooms, octopuses, and much more this season. The first season has ended; the new one will start Fall 2024.

Tune into The Dirt, a weekly gardening brief for the Upper Valley, hosted by KTNA’s Jenny Willoughby. It’s the what, when, where, and how-to garden guide for any hopeful gardener.
